The dental bone graft procedure
- Consultation & Scan: Begin with a free consultation and a 3D CT scan to assess your current bone levels and suitability, and to determine whether grafting is required and the level needed.
- Treatment Plan: If there’s insufficient bone, Dr Nagpal will carefully plan your treatment around your bone anatomy, structure, smile and implant placement.
- The Grafting Procedure: We’ll place the bone graft material into the area with bone loss to rebuild volume where we plan on placing the implant. It’s carried out under local anaesthetic with sedation available for nervous patients. Typically takes around an hour. Simultaneous implant placement is possible in some cases.
- Healing & Integration: Over a few months, we will allow the graft to heal and integrate with your natural bone. Time varies depending on the size of the graft. Typically, timelines take 3-6 months.
- Dental Implant Placement: Once healing is complete, dental implants can be placed into the restored area of the bone. A few months later, once the implant has bonded with the bone, the final crown, bridge, or denture can be placed to complete your smile.

Bone graft for implants FAQs
Why would I need a bone graft before dental implants?
As dental implants are placed directly into the bone in your jaw and rely on a good volume to remain stable long-term, you’ll need enough healthy jawbone for them to be successful.
Does everyone need a bone graft for implants?
No. Many of our past patients have had implants without grafting, especially with innovative full-mouth systems like All-on-4, which are placed at an angle to maximise available bone.
Is a dental bone graft painful at The Smiles Studio?
Treatment is carried out under local anaesthetic, with sedation available for nervous patients at both of The Smiles Studio clinics in Chandler’s Ford & Lymington.
How long does a bone graft take to heal?
Initial recovery usually takes a few weeks, but integration typically takes between 3 and 6 months.
Can implants be placed at the same time as a bone graft?
In some cases, yes. This depends on the amount of readily available bone Dr Nagpal identifies.
What causes jawbone loss?
Bone loss typically occurs after missing teeth go ignored, gum disease develops, denture wear is prolonged, trauma occurs, or infection occurs.
Will a bone graft improve implant success?
Bone grafting helps create stronger support for implants and improves long-term stability.
Are bone grafts safe?
Bone grafting is a well-established and commonly performed procedure in implant dentistry.
What happens if I don’t have enough bone for implants?
Without sufficient bone support, implants may not integrate or remain stable over the long term, leading to loosening or failure.
